How does Windows Defender work?

Windows Defender is a robust antivirus software that scans your PC for malware, viruses, and other threats. It works by:

  • Real-time monitoring of system files and applications

  • Regular scanning of the computer for potential threats

  • Alerting users to potential security issues

By understanding how Windows Defender functions, you can make informed decisions about its use and potential alternatives.
